summ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Max Kalika <max@gentoo.org>2003-08-25 18:47:06 +0000
committerMax Kalika <max@gentoo.org>2003-08-25 18:47:06 +0000
commit634e8e4ad4613d3688d15c10023848b0ea4244fe (patch)
tree775bd167aaeab4680e01e4e9e4a8b20d8fce7d22 /media-libs/libdv
parentversion bump (diff)
downloadgentoo-2-634e8e4ad4613d3688d15c10023848b0ea4244fe.tar.gz
gentoo-2-634e8e4ad4613d3688d15c10023848b0ea4244fe.tar.bz2
gentoo-2-634e8e4ad4613d3688d15c10023848b0ea4244fe.zip
Fix patch to detect libXv properly and trim some DEPENDs.
Diffstat (limited to 'media-libs/libdv')
-rw-r--r--media-libs/libdv/ChangeLog7
-rw-r--r--media-libs/libdv/Manifest6
-rw-r--r--media-libs/libdv/files/libdv-0.99-disablegtk.patch19
-rw-r--r--media-libs/libdv/libdv-0.99-r1.ebuild6
4 files changed, 26 insertions, 12 deletions
diff --git a/media-libs/libdv/ChangeLog b/media-libs/libdv/ChangeLog
index 08fecdbd0d3f..b0da53d0dd55 100644
--- a/media-libs/libdv/ChangeLog
+++ b/media-libs/libdv/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for media-libs/libdv
#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.18 2003/08/21 21:34:21 max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/ChangeLog,v 1.19 2003/08/25 18:47:05 max Exp $
+
+ 25 Aug 2003; Max Kalika <max@gentoo.org> libdv-0.99-r1.ebuild,
+ files/libdv-0.99-disablegtk.patch:
+ Fix patch to detect libXv properly. Remove dependency on pkgconfig. Remove
+ dependency on glib (pulled by gtk+ already). Add debug to IUSE.
21 Aug 2003; Max Kalika <max@gentoo.org> libdv-0.99-r1.ebuild:
Use more portage internals.
diff --git a/media-libs/libdv/Manifest b/media-libs/libdv/Manifest
index aa93a0092530..850a491b1a4b 100644
--- a/media-libs/libdv/Manifest
+++ b/media-libs/libdv/Manifest
@@ -1,10 +1,10 @@
MD5 55706adc4e35f4c4402d2b93bbe1379f libdv-0.9.5-r1.ebuild 805
MD5 d007c88d554ddc43791b174155f90069 libdv-0.99.ebuild 923
MD5 5e11191017e9473641ac1a378b2afb96 libdv-0.98.ebuild 1049
-MD5 7077bd64f60f0a41519db4e67ac99435 ChangeLog 2497
+MD5 9d356048b2ce7dc32124cc9808c77ae1 ChangeLog 2743
MD5 2fdf7d119ea8a49fe28913e77b44dfc0 metadata.xml 333
-MD5 687ca7a25d7d99a50b31fc73232fdbf6 libdv-0.99-r1.ebuild 1104
-MD5 65d548197c98dd25eca308b025f0cc07 files/libdv-0.99-disablegtk.patch 2948
+MD5 a397f28cb4fecb3e3a00cf354453b632 libdv-0.99-r1.ebuild 1060
+MD5 7c723a6fa5d934edd24e19d114121d49 files/libdv-0.99-disablegtk.patch 3302
MD5 a880f41dce1a820076b48ca914ac5e8b files/digest-libdv-0.9.5-r1 63
MD5 d79d611e171b21dfe5e1f5d1534576e5 files/digest-libdv-0.98 62
MD5 108d55b61056533255db29dbed106beb files/digest-libdv-0.99 123
diff --git a/media-libs/libdv/files/libdv-0.99-disablegtk.patch b/media-libs/libdv/files/libdv-0.99-disablegtk.patch
index 80ab5200dd83..b3329d831182 100644
--- a/media-libs/libdv/files/libdv-0.99-disablegtk.patch
+++ b/media-libs/libdv/files/libdv-0.99-disablegtk.patch
@@ -1,5 +1,6 @@
---- libdv-0.99/Makefile.in 2003-05-13 10:47:47.000000000 +0200
-+++ libdv-0.99/Makefile.in 2003-05-13 10:47:54.000000000 +0200
+diff -ruN libdv-0.99/Makefile.in libdv-0.99/Makefile.in
+--- libdv-0.99/Makefile.in 2003-01-02 09:40:44.000000000 -0800
++++ libdv-0.99/Makefile.in 2003-08-25 11:16:40.000000000 -0700
@@ -101,7 +101,7 @@
am__include = @am__include@
am__quote = @am__quote@
@@ -9,8 +10,9 @@
AUX_DIST = $(ac_aux_dir)/config.guess \
$(ac_aux_dir)/config.sub \
---- libdv-0.99/configure 2003-05-20 11:01:08.000000000 +0200
-+++ libdv-0.99/configure 2003-05-20 11:03:23.000000000 +0200
+diff -ruN libdv-0.99/configure libdv-0.99/configure
+--- libdv-0.99/configure 2003-01-02 09:40:46.000000000 -0800
++++ libdv-0.99/configure 2003-08-25 11:17:30.000000000 -0700
@@ -7651,6 +7651,7 @@
@@ -35,6 +37,15 @@
+@@ -8362,7 +8367,7 @@
+ echo $ECHO_N "(cached) $ECHO_C" >&6
+ else
+ ac_check_lib_save_LIBS=$LIBS
+-LIBS="-lXv $GTK_LIBS $LIBS"
++LIBS="-lXv -L/usr/X11R6/lib $LIBS"
+ cat >conftest.$ac_ext <<_ACEOF
+ #line $LINENO "configure"
+ #include "confdefs.h"
@@ -9978,8 +9983,11 @@
diff --git a/media-libs/libdv/libdv-0.99-r1.ebuild b/media-libs/libdv/libdv-0.99-r1.ebuild
index ef5f950f135c..4050a4cd08bc 100644
--- a/media-libs/libdv/libdv-0.99-r1.ebuild
+++ b/media-libs/libdv/libdv-0.99-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-0.99-r1.ebuild,v 1.2 2003/08/21 21:34:21 max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-libs/libdv/libdv-0.99-r1.ebuild,v 1.3 2003/08/25 18:47:05 max Exp $
DESCRIPTION="Software codec for dv-format video (camcorders etc)."
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
@@ -9,12 +9,10 @@ HOMEPAGE="http://libdv.sourceforge.net/"
SLOT="0"
LICENSE="GPL-2"
KEYWORDS="~x86 ~ppc ~sparc ~alpha ~amd64"
-IUSE="sdl gtk xv"
+IUSE="debug gtk sdl xv"
DEPEND="dev-libs/popt
- dev-util/pkgconfig
gtk? ( =x11-libs/gtk+-1.2* )
- gtk? ( =dev-libs/glib-1.2* )
sdl? ( >=media-libs/libsdl-1.2.4.20020601 )
xv? ( virtual/x11 )"